INS Vikrant: How Indian Navy's Carrier Reshapes Power In The Indian Ocean

Published on: Feb. 3, 2026, 2:08 p.m. | Source: Times Now

INS Vikrant is India’s first indigenously designed, built and commissioned aircraft carrier — a landmark achievement in the nation’s defence and shipbuilding history. Commissioned in September 2022, the 45,000-tonne warship built by Cochin Shipyard and designed by the Indian Navy’s Warship Design Bureau, is now fully operational with the Western Fleet and capable of carrying a diverse air wing, including MiG-29K fighters, helicopters and naval combat aircraft. It has completed extensive operational validation exercises and showcased India’s maritime reach in the Indian Ocean and beyond, underscoring the country’s growing blue-water naval capabilities and strategic self-reliance.
